How they compare
Botswana currently reports 11.5% against 11.4% in Canada,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Botswana ahead.
Botswana ranks 22nd and Canada ranks 23rd of 148 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Botswana averaged higher in 1 and Canada in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Botswana | Canada |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 10.1% | 9.9% | 0.1% | Botswana |
| 2010s | 10.7% | 11.2% | 0.5% | Canada |
| 2020s | 11.2% | 11.4% | 0.3% | Canada |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
